JOB SUMMARY
The RN in the Family Birth Center provides safe nursing care in a timely manner to patients on the assigned unit with a high degree of independence. Performs within the scope of a RN as defined by the Vermont State Board of Nursing. Pay Range $36.0000 to $56.7100 USD
PRE-REQUISITES
Education:
 Graduate of an accredited school of nursing or enrolled in an accredited Direct Entry to Master of Science in Nursing Program with current licensure as a Registered Nurse in the State of Vermont (VT RN license or Compact State RN), BSN preferred
Experience:
2-3 years L&D experience. Successful completion of FBC orientation and IV certification. Previous clinical experience in obstetrical, pediatric and neonatal nursing preferred.
Certifications Required:
Intermediate/Advanced EFM course and NRP certification. PALS or proficiency/education in obstetric emergencies encouraged;
BLS RELATIONSHIPS
Reports To:
FBC Nurse Director Other Contacts:
Shift administrator, physicians, patients, families, visitors, public, forensic staff, hospital staff, and other healthcare practitioners
SCOPE:
Machinery or Equipment Used:
Patient monitoring devices, cast removal saw, IV pumps, patient transport devices, needles/syringes, computer, basic office equipment, and other patient care equipment
Physical Demands:
Occasional sitting, lifting up to 50 lbs., kneeling, crouching, overhead reaching, and awkward positions. Frequent twisting, bending, squatting, stooping, reaching and pushing/pulling. Constant standing and walking
Working Conditions:
Exposure to crisis situations and unpleasant elements of acute traumatic injuries, accidents and illness. Frequently exposed to the risk of blood borne diseases. Exposed to hazards from electrical equipment. Occasionally subjected to irregular hours and stress/pressure due to multiple patient needs
Required Protective Equipment:
All Personal Protective Equipment and situation and patient condition dictates
